datastrukturer Pekare, abstrakta datatyper och speciella medlemsfunktioner Klas Arvidsson 2020, Oskar Holmström 2019 Institutionen för datavetenskap. Agenda 1 Pekare i klass, destruktor 2 Dynamiska datastrukturer 3 Speciella medlemsfunktioner 4 ADT: Abstrakta DataTyper (vector, stack, queue, map)

2113

Datastrukturer och algoritmer Föreläsning 1-2 Datastrukturer Datastrukturer och algoritmer och algoritmer VT08 Innehåll Kurspresentation och information ¾Innehållsöversikt, upplägg, kursmaterial, kursutvärdering, förväntade studie resultat etc

Denna kurswebb är gemensam för dt046g och dt064g. Webbplatsen innehåller sånär som på kurslitteratur, den information du behöver för att genomföra kursen. Kursens mål. Kursen är en labb- och tentabaserad kurs. Kursen introducerar algoritmanalys och består bland annat av följande moment.

Datastrukturer

  1. Fairtrade barnarbete
  2. Wellplast ab munka ljungby
  3. Borsens utveckling 100 ar
  4. Lön copywriter 2021

Programming languages all have built-in data structures, but these often differ from one language to another. This article attempts to list the built-in data structures available in JavaScript and what properties they have; these can be used to build other data structures. Wherever possible, comparisons with other languages are drawn. Datastrukturer er en fællesbetegnelse for data, der er organiserede i elementer, som kan tilføjes eller fjernes fra strukturen. Nogle datastrukturer forudsætter, at dataelementerne hver har et nøglefelt, der kan sorteres efter. Man kan som udgangspunkt udføre følgende operationer på datastrukturer: Indsætte elementer; Fjerne elementer Övningar: Datastrukturer och algoritmer.

Grundläggande abstrakta datatyper som behandlas är bland andra lista, stack, kö, träd, mängd, graf och tabell. Datatypernas informella och formella specifikationer, generella egenskaper och användningsområden liksom olika implementationsmöjligheter och deras specifika egenskaper behandlas. Datastrukturer och algoritmer.

ad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020 ad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020 ad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020

Algoritmer och avancerade datastrukturer. 7,5 hp. Syftet med kursen är att ge kunskap om hur man skapar och använder datastrukturer och algoritmer och hur  Datastruktur, sätt på vilket data lagras för effektiv sökning och hämtning.

datainnehåll, begrepp och datastrukturer som avses i 12 § 2 mom. i lagen om sekundär användning. Den ska iakttas av alla 

Datastrukturer

Syftet med kursen är att ge kunskap om hur man skapar och använder datastrukturer och algoritmer och hur   In computer science, a data structure is a data organization, management, and storage format that enables efficient access and modification. More precisely, a   Exempel på datastrukturer är klassifikationer, blankettstrukturer, teststrukturer, registeruppgifter och tekniska kodverk samt nomenklaturer och terminologier av  Algoritmer och datastrukturer spelar en fundamental roll inom datavetenskap. Datastrukturer används för att modellera verkligheten och valet av repres. Uke 35 ✓ Datastrukturer. Trær traversering og rekursjon ✓ Grafalgoritmer. Hashing ✓ Topologisk sortering.

Datastrukturer

En sådan  Träd finns ej som gränssnitt i Java Collections Framework men är en mycket viktig typ av datastruktur. För mer om träd, se sektion 5. 3.6 Cirkulär array. En array  Inom programmering är en 'datastruktur' en struktur för att organisera data. Valet av Vi har “Linjära datastrukturer” (Lista, Stack, Kö, etc.). Abstrakta datatyper; Datastrukturer och algoritmer, med fokus både på imperativa, objektorienterade och funktionella språk; Enkel komplexitetsanalys av imperativ  Datastrukturer och algoritmer (C). Antal högskolepoäng 7,5 hp; Nivå Grundnivå fortsättningskurs; Starttid Vårtermin 2021.
Fängslade journalister i etiopien

Datastrukturer

Kakor, som också kallas cookies, hjälper oss att utveckla vår webbtjänst och förbättra dess innehåll och tillgänglighet. En del av kakorna är nödvändiga för att sidorna ska fungera korrekt. • Vanliga datastrukturer och abstrakta datatyper, såsom fält (arrayer), stackar, köer, länkade listor, träd och hashtabeller.

datastrukturer.
Blocket restaurang göteborg






Exempel på datastrukturer är klassifikationer, blankettstrukturer, teststrukturer, registeruppgifter och tekniska kodverk samt nomenklaturer och terminologier av 

Det finns en till vanlig typ av datastruktur, Hash tables , vilket är den snabbaste datastrukturen för key/value data. Introduktion till kursen. Abstrakta datatyper och datastrukturer. Standardstrukturer.


Cecilia lindén

ad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020 ad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020 adk20 - Algoritmer, datastrukturer och komplexitet, hösten 2020

Uno Holmer. holmer@chalmers.se. Tentamenshjälpmedel för. Algoritmer och. datastrukturer. 1 (7). Algoritmer och datastrukturer utgör grunden för alla program.